EC Fines Intel For Illegal Practices

 

The European Commission (EC) sent a strong message to the world yesterday, as it fined Intel Corp. a record EUR 1.06B for using illegal practices to maintain market dominance. Though Intel is appealing the ruling, which also orders it to halt these tactics, things do not look good for the world’s biggest chipmaker which paid computer manufacturers to delay or end plans to use chips that were made by rival company Advanced Micro Devices Inc. (AMD). Not surprisingly, Intel’s stock fell 0.53% to US$ 15.13 at yesterday’s close.
